i have two jack dempseys cichlids (one male and one female about 3-4 inchs) in my 55gal since Nov22.
i started feeding them "TetraMin Tropical Flakes" and had 6 minnow gold fish for them to eat.

Dec5, i bought "Hikari Cichlid Gold" and "Hikari frozen Blood worms"

tonight while i was feeding them the blood worms, i noticed the blue spots, red along the fin, and the blue around mouth of the male got a lot brighter and prettier

for the female, she started off pretty dark and not to long ago her color has faded and is alot lighter. i noticed this change around Dec4
tonight when she had some blood worms, the blue around her mouth got alot brighter, but her body still isnt as dark as it used to be

any ideas?
 
hikari is a very good brand of fish food. i use hikari gold on all my fish and it definitely improves their colour and health. as for your female being a light body colour, IME my females have always been alot lighter than my males.
